Council for Children and Families About US Born in Poland Tatiana SikoraStrachan earned her first Masters Degree in Earth Science. In 1985 she came to the United States where she discovered her love for teaching young children and she committed herself to a career working with children and training the professionals who serve them. Year 1995 marked the incorporation of The Council for Children and Families CCF a nonprofit organization dedicated to developing successful childcare professionals. In 2001 Tatiana completed her second Graduate program with a Masters in Early Childhood Education from The City College in NYC.
